Rural Preservation District
The regulations of Rural Preservation Districts are intended to foster agricultural, forestry, mineral resource extraction, and aquacultural uses and protect the land base necessary to support these activities. Low density residential development in this type of district is permitted subject to performance standards that maintain the rural character of the district in recognition of the fact that a full range of public facilities is not provided or planned. The farmer has the right to farm without being restricted by neighboring residential areas. Restricted hours of operation for farm equipment, restricted odor-producing fertilizers, or mandatory noise reductions may not be imposed on farmers in an RPD zoning district. The general intent of the district is to encourage farming without undue burden on the landowner. In accordance with these intentions, the following provisions for the protection of agricultural uses will apply: (1) Any farm use of land is permitted. (2) Operation, at any time, of machinery used in farm production or the primary processing of agricultural products is permitted. (3) Normal agricultural activities and operations in accordance with good husbandry practices, which do not cause bodily injury or directly endanger human health, are permitted and preferred activities, including activities that may produce normal agriculture related noise and odors. (4) The sale of farm products produced on the farm where the sales are made is permitted.
